Winchester Model 1886 Saddle Ring Carbine

serial #119356, 45-70, 22" round barrel with full magazine and a very good bore that shows a little light pitting. The barrel and magazine retain about 50% original blue finish, which is thinning evenly and blending with a pleasing smooth brown patina. The action retains about 40% original color casehardened finish which is mostly faded to a silvery, color but does show some contrast in protected areas. The balance of the action has acquired a pleasing gray patina and is blending nicely with the remaining finish. The plain walnut stocks rate very good plus with a little light oil added and some scattered light marks, however they are pleasing in appearance and have not been sanded. A nice honest example of the scarce and desirable 1886 carbine manufactured in 1899. (2196-1) {C&R} (5000/7000) SOLD FOR $8050.00
